Clerk reads two Senate files; first reading and referral to committee announced
Summary
The clerk announced Senate File 2468 and Senate File 2490 for first reading and referred both to the committee on Ways and Means; bill details were read aloud but substantive debate was not held.

The clerk read captions for two Senate files during the opening minutes and announced them for first reading and referral to committee.
The clerk stated: "Senate file 2468 by committee on ways and means a bill for an act providing for conversation and partnership into other forms of domestic or foreign organizations and providing for fees." The clerk also read: "Senate file 2490 by committee on ways and means a bill for an act relating to oil and gas production including filling requirements and the authority of the Department of Natural Resources, confidential information, pooling orders, negotiation of surface damage..." Both files were announced for first reading and referred to the committee on Ways and Means. The transcript does not record further debate or vote on either measure during this session; additional details and bill texts were "not specified" in the record provided.
